There is another side-issue with the growth of AI - the sheer amount of power it consumes:


What with more and more electric cars needing charging, and the overall need to phase out fossil fuels were going to need some serious investment in power generation. A few more windmills and solar panels isn't going to be enough.
Not just power, but water to keep the underlying hardware cool:

In terms of water consumption, analysis from the University of California found that ChatGPT consumes just over one 500ml bottle of water per 100-word request. (Source)

As someone who works for an AI company, energy consumption - and its impacts - is something which I'm both aware of, and troubled by.

There is another side-issue with the growth of AI - the sheer amount of power it consumes:


What with more and more electric cars needing charging, and the overall need to phase out fossil fuels were going to need some serious investment in power generation. A few more windmills and solar panels isn't going to be enough.

It would not surprise me if a new SMR is located close to the UK data centre. Google has recently ordered 6/7 SMR‘s for their AI data centres.


Amazon Web Services (AWS) have also bought a data centre that is nuclear powered.
